Before we dive into the uses of slurry pumps, let’s simplify what a slurry pump is. A slurry pump is a type of pump designed to move mixtures of liquid and solid particles (known as slurries) efficiently. These pumps are crucial in industries like mining, construction, and wastewater treatment.

Slurry pumps are widely used in the mining industry to transport slurries containing various ores. For instance, a company like MineCorp reported a 30% increase in efficiency when they switched to a more suitable slurry pump model. This switch reduced downtime and labor costs, making it a highly cost-effective decision.
In wastewater treatment plants, slurry pumps handle sludge and other solid waste. An average plant that employs high-efficiency slurry pumps can expect to see a reduction in energy costs by up to 15%. For instance, CityWater's trial of advanced slurry pumps showed a reduced energy expense of $50,000 annually, resulting in faster returns on investment.
Slurry pumps can mix and transport concrete and other site materials. This use is especially beneficial in areas with harsh conditions where traditional methods are less effective. Builders have noted a 25% reduction in project completion times when integrating slurry pumps into their processes.
